Rockstar launches GTA IV site, teases about multiplayer

For those itching to get their hands on the next game in the Grand Theft Auto series, April 29th just can't come fast enough. If you're looking for something to tide you over (or torture you) until the release day comes, you'll be happy to see that Rockstar has launched the official GTA IV website.

The site shows you the skyline of New York City Liberty City where you'll spend your days stealing cars, beating up hookers and sipping some hot coffee. Well, you probably won't get any hot coffee. There are plenty of screenshots for you to drool over and a mysterious "Multiplayer" button that simply rolls over to say "Coming Soon."

So just what kind of multiplayer action can we look forward to? Co-op, death matches, races, who knows? For now, Rockstar seems content with the little teaser. We'll let you know once something is confirmed.
